When asked to explain the infamous angle where Ric Flair was left for dead and buried in a desert and then why he later just showed up again without it ever being mentioned again, Russo explains why he felt that he needed to take Flair off of TV... but never once does he consider that perhaps everyone's issue with his decision was not the fact that he decided to take Flair off of TV, but the fact that the thought it would be a good idea to BURY A MAN ALIVE IN THE DESERT... and then to NOT FOLLOW UP ON IT AT ALL! It's like it never even crossed his mind that you could just have him get assaulted and beaten bloody. Nope. Burying him in the desert was definitely the way to go in Russo's mind. WHAT A MORON!

I think he was just doing his usual "I remember this random thing that happened in the 80's that no one else remembers so I'll do it again for nostalgia....although no one friggin remembers what the hell I'm talking about." There was an instance in the 80's where the Horsemen beat up Dusty Rhodes and left him out in the desert (I think they show it on that Four Horsemen DVD). Of course, Russo can't progress an angle (or really do anything at all) without trying to be controversial so he has them "bury" him. either way, talk about abusing an idea; how many "abduction" angles has Russo come up with? Wasn't Joe AND Sting abducted at certain points when Russo wrote TNA?
